Tampa-Specific Notes for 40-Yard Rentals

In Tampa, 40-yard containers are primarily for large storm cleanup operations, full demolitions, and commercial work. They need flat-bed delivery trucks and require at least 22–25 feet of driveway clearance and 14+ feet overhead. In South Tampa's older neighborhoods (Hyde Park, Seminole Heights), access for a 40-yard truck can be physically impossible — confirm access before booking. Post-hurricane, 40-yard containers are the first to disappear from operator inventories.

Booking Checklist

  1. Confirm weight limit and overage rate — wet/storm debris weighs more than expected
  2. Check county coverage if you're near Pinellas or Pasco lines
  3. Decide on placement — driveway needs no permit; street placement requires a city permit ($45–$85)
  4. Book early during hurricane season (June–November) — availability can collapse post-storm

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a 40-yard dumpster cost in Tampa FL?

A 40-yard dumpster in Tampa typically costs $460–$670 for a standard 7–10 day rental. Off-season (December–February) rates are often 5–15% lower. Pinellas or Pasco County delivery may add a $25–$65 surcharge.

What's the weight limit on a 40-yard dumpster in Tampa?

Most Tampa operators include 5–8 tons in the base price. Overage fees run $55–$80 per ton over the limit. For storm debris or water-damaged materials, weight limits are hit faster than on dry loads — always confirm before booking.

How long can I keep a 40-yard dumpster in Tampa?

Standard rentals are 7–10 days. Extensions typically cost $10–$20 per day. Ask about extended rates upfront if your project may run longer — it's almost always cheaper than requesting an extension after delivery.

Do I need a permit for a 40-yard dumpster in Tampa?

Only if it goes on a public street. Driveway placement requires no permit. Street placement requires a City of Tampa right-of-way permit ($45–$85, 2–5 days to process). Many operators handle it — ask when booking.
